What changed here
DerivedIndian National Congress held the seat; the winning margin narrowed from 52.6% to 17.0%.
- Won on a lower shareIts own vote share fell 15.1% — it held because the rest of the vote was more divided.
- Runner-up changedSecond place passed from Janata Dal (JD) to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P).
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 91.5% of the vote between them, up from 86.1% — a tighter two-way contest.
